In New Jersey, the Attorney General has the authority to issue statements of statewide policy, known as “law enforcement directives,” that are binding on all 38,000 state, county, and local law enforcement officers in New Jersey. Over the past several years, Attorney General Grewal has used his directive authority to enact a range of ...NJ Office of the Attorney General. Medicaid Fraud Control Unit. P.O. Box 094. AG Directive 2021-6 requires each law enforcement agency in New Jersey to submit to the Attorney General an annual report of all major discipline imposed by that agency on its officers. “Major discipline” is defined as terminations, reductions in rank, or suspension of more than five days. The Division of Gaming Enforcement (DGE) is a law enforcement agency and the investigative arm of the casino regulatory system responsible for enforcing the Casino Control Act. DGE’s workforce consists of attorneys, investigators, and accountants, and is supported by New Jersey State Troopers and DCJ prosecutors.New Jersey State employees may have received emails impersonating the NJ Office of the Attorney General (OAG). An expungement is the removal, sealing, impounding, or isolation of all records on file within any court, detention or correctional facility, law enforcement or criminal justice agency. A court-ordered expungement can remove the following information: your arrest. all court proceedings related to your case. your criminal or juvenile conviction.Nov 1, 2023 · Welcome to NJOAG.GOV – the new website of the New Jersey Office of the Attorney General. While these messages have been blocked, we are making you aware out of an abundance of caution and ask ...The Senate Judiciary Committee advanced the nomination of acting Attorney General Matt Platkin Monday after a two-and-a-half hearing where Platkin faced …Early years of the office (1704-1946) The position of New Jersey Attorney General was first established in 1704, shortly after the provinces of East Jersey and West Jersey were reunited as a single colony. The royal governor, Lord Cornbury, appointed Alexander Griffith to serve as the first Attorney General, a position he held until 1714.Patricia Teffenhart is the Executive Director of the Division of Violence Intervention and Victim Assistance (VIVA). Mar 12, 2024 · In addition, DCJ assists the Attorney General in his role as the State’s chief law enforcement officer, which pursuant to the Criminal Justice Act of 1970, gives the Attorney General broad supervisory authority over New Jersey’s 21 County Prosecutors’ Offices and the State’s 38,000 law enforcement officers. Find out …The Attorney General of New Jersey is a member of the executive cabinet of the state and is the state’s chief law enforcement officer and legal advisor. The office is appointed by the Governor of New Jersey and is term limited. Under the provisions of the New Jersey State Constitution, the attorney general serves a four-year term concurrent ...New Jersey State employees may have received emails impersonating the NJ Office of the Attorney General (OAG). The New Jersey Attorney General has broad oversight of the state’s legal and law enforcement matters. As the head of the Department of Law & Public Safety, the Attorney General supervises a wide range of Divisions, Offices, and Commissions, consisting of 2,800 uniformed officers, 600 lawyers, and thousands of other public servants.
